c语言函数参数的正确使用方法

更新时间:02-08 教程 由 傲骨 分享

C语言函数参数的正确使用方法

在C语言中,函数参数的正确使用方法是非常重要的。一个函数的参数可以影响函数的行为和输出结果。在编写函数时,我们需要仔细考虑参数的类型、数量和顺序等因素。

1. 参数类型

在C语言中,参数可以是各种不同的类型,例如整数、字符、指针等等。当我们定义函数时,需要指定每个参数的类型。在调用函数时,我们需要传递与函数参数类型匹配的值。如果函数需要一个整数参数,我们需要传递一个整数值。如果函数需要一个指针参数,我们需要传递一个指向正确类型的指针。

2. 参数数量

在C语言中,函数可以有任意数量的参数。这些参数可以是必需的或可选的。当我们定义函数时,需要指定每个必需参数的数量和类型。如果函数有可选参数,我们需要使用省略号(...)来表示它们。以下是一个带有三个必需参数和一个可选参数的函数的定义

```tttt c, ...);

在调用此函数时,我们需要传递三个整数值,并可以选择传递更多的参数。在函数内部,我们可以使用stdarg.h头文件中的函数来访问这些可变参数。

3. 参数顺序

在C语言中,函数的参数顺序非常重要。参数的顺序可以影响函数的行为和输出结果。在定义和调用函数时,我们需要仔细考虑参数的顺序。以下是一个计算两个数之和的函数的定义

```ttt b);

在调用此函数时,我们需要将两个数作为参数传递给函数。如果我们交换参数的顺序,函数将返回错误的结果。

在C语言中,函数参数的正确使用方法是非常重要的。我们需要仔细考虑参数的类型、数量和顺序等因素。只有这样,我们才能编写出高效、可靠的函数。我们应该在编写函数时,仔细考虑参数的使用方法,并在调用函数时,遵循正确的参数传递方式。

声明:关于《c语言函数参数的正确使用方法》以上内容仅供参考,若您的权利被侵害,请联系13825271@qq.com
本文网址:http://www.25820.com/tutorial/14_2123279.html